Transaction 73f042bda87015e0db703903e6c035aa398a61eee62f0137abc25fc6efc726f6

3 Input
1 Outputs
  • 73f042bda87015e0db703903e6c035aa398a61eee62f0137abc25fc6efc726f6:0
  • value  2234098
    address  3QTxRaujfbCsFS1v8pPSPwzT1h9USZa8kS